Samsung Galaxy C9: the smartphone was spotted on TENAA

Samsung working on the next Galaxy C9 and information on the smartphone has leaked for some time. The South Korean company even teased smartphone on social networking sites in China and the phone was recently spotted on TENAA too.
Steve Hemmerstoffer A spotted the Galaxy on TENAA C9 and the list reveals some details about the upcoming smartphone, as well as multiple images.

The Galaxy C9 could come with a screen 6-inch Super AMOLED with a resolution of 1080p and a fingerprint sensor. The images on the run of the Galaxy C9 show that the smartphone uses a new antenna system with three thin lines at the top and bottom, according to SamMobile. The lines are of the same color as the rest of the back of the device. In addition, the phone has a gold-colored aluminum design. The rear camera LED flash seems to have two tones. C9 The Galaxy carries the model number SM-C9000 and the phone was recently spotted at the FCC, which means it could be made available in other countries than China. The smartphone has also been spotted on benchmarking sites.



Samsung Galaxy C9 could feature a 16MP camera on the front

Rumors say that the smartphone could come with a Qualcomm Snapdragon processor 625 and up to 6 GB of RAM. In addition, the capacity of the rear camera could reach 16MP 16MP sensor with a front to snap selfies and conduct video calls. The battery capacity can reach 4000 mAh and the phone may have 64 GB of internal memory. The Galaxy C9 could run Android 6.0.1 out of the box Marshmallow and could receive Android 7.0 update soon Nougat. Some say that the smartphone will be available in China in late October and in the US in mid-November, but it remains to be seen. It is unclear whether Samsung will release the smartphone in Europe
